PEKIN AREA CHAMBER OF COMMERCE, founded in 1917, is a small nonprofit that reported $261K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ue surged 21%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. The organization ran a surplus of $54K, a strong 21% operating margin.

Mission

TO FOSTER AND PROMOTE A VIBRANT BUSINESS ENVIRONMENT THAT IMPROVES THE QUALITY OF LIFE IN THE PEKIN AREA.
